Organ Transplant Immunosuppressant Drug Market Size

According to Reports Insights Consulting Pvt Ltd, The Organ Transplant Immunosuppressant Drug Market is projected to grow at a Compound Annual Growth Rate (CAGR) of 6.8% between 2025 and 2033. The market is estimated at USD 8.1 Billion in 2025 and is projected to reach USD 13.7 Billion by the end of the forecast period in 2033.

Organ Transplant Immunosuppressant Drug Market Restraints Analysis

The Organ Transplant Immunosuppressant Drug Market faces significant restraints, primarily stemming from the high cost associated with these medications, which can pose a substantial financial burden on patients and healthcare systems. The lifelong nature of immunosuppressive therapy means that the cumulative cost can be prohibitive, particularly in regions with limited insurance coverage or lower per capita income. This economic barrier can restrict patient access and adherence, potentially leading to poorer transplant outcomes and limiting market expansion in cost-sensitive segments.

Another considerable restraint is the array of significant side effects and long-term complications associated with immunosuppressant drugs. These can include increased susceptibility to infections, nephrotoxicity, cardiovascular issues, and an elevated risk of malignancies, which necessitate intensive monitoring and additional medical interventions. Such adverse effects often lead to patient non-adherence, drug discontinuation, or the need for therapy adjustments, adding complexity to patient management and potentially impacting drug sales. Furthermore, the stringent regulatory approval processes for new drugs, coupled with the long and expensive R&D cycle, also act as a restraint by delaying market entry for innovative therapies and increasing development costs for pharmaceutical companies.

Key Trends
Segments Covered
  • By Drug Class:
    • Calcineurin Inhibitors (e.g., Cyclosporine, Tacrolimus)
    • Antiproliferative Agents (e.g., Mycophenolate Mofetil, Azathioprine)
    • mTOR Inhibitors (e.g., Sirolimus, Everolimus)
    • Steroids (e.g., Prednisone, Methylprednisolone)
    • Monoclonal Antibodies (e.g., Basiliximab, Daclizumab)
    • Polyclonal Antibodies (e.g., Antithymocyte Globulin)
    • Other Immunosuppressants
  • By Indication:
    • Kidney Transplant
    • Liver Transplant
    • Heart Transplant
    • Lung Transplant
    • Pancreas Transplant
    • Other Organ Transplants (e.g., Intestinal, Bone Marrow)
  • By Route of Administration:
    • Oral
    • Injectable
  • By Distribution Channel:
    • Hospital Pharmacies
    • Retail Pharmacies
    • Online Pharmacies

Regional Highlights

  • North America: Dominates the market due to a high number of organ transplant procedures, advanced healthcare infrastructure, high healthcare expenditure, and the presence of key market players and robust R&D activities. The U.S. remains the largest market.
  • Europe: Represents a significant market share, driven by a growing aging population, increasing prevalence of chronic diseases, well-established healthcare systems, and favorable government initiatives supporting organ donation and transplantation in countries like Germany, France, and the UK.
  • Asia Pacific (APAC): Projected to be the fastest-growing region, fueled by improving healthcare infrastructure, increasing awareness about organ donation, a large patient pool, rising disposable incomes, and the expansion of medical tourism in countries such as China, India, and Japan.
  • Latin America: An emerging market experiencing growth due to increasing government investments in healthcare, improving access to advanced medical treatments, and a rising number of transplant centers, particularly in Brazil and Mexico.
  • Middle East and Africa (MEA): Shows gradual growth, propelled by increasing healthcare spending, development of specialized medical facilities, and rising awareness campaigns regarding organ donation and transplantation in countries like Saudi Arabia and South Africa.
